Overview""When they emerged from the lava tube and got their first sight of the lunar surface, Harper's breath caught in her throat. Rocky and vast-and pockmarked with craters of varying size-the monochromatic grey expanse extended in every direction to a dark horizon that genuflected before a star-speckled infinity. It made Harper feel very small indeed. And humble; like kneeling at the feet of God..."" Stranded some 239,000 miles from Earth by the most devastating celestial disaster since the extinction of the dinosaurs, UN Agent Harper Reardon has become an ad hoc investigator with the Lunar Security Corps, the New Eden colony's police force. In the months since successfully solving the case that brought her to the moon (something that put her permanently on LSC Captain Fiona Krieg's shit-list!), Harper and her team-Detective Constable Calvin Mendoza and the android RD-482-have found themselves assigned the dregs of the Corps' cases; gifts from her colleague-cum-nemesis undoubtedly accompanied by a self-satisfied smirk and a middle-finger salute! As a result, when Krieg unexpectedly announces she has a murder for them, Harper is more than a tad suspicious... And according to Mendoza, she should be. There's a body alright but it's not on the moon, it's at one of the asteroid mining camps-which Cal assures her are the colony's armpits and the worst possible assignment. Intrigued-and being an admitted foot-stomping contrarian-Harper snatches up the gauntlet Krieg has thrown down... Just who was Reuben Paltrow and who among the miners would want to kill him in such a public, twisted way? The mining clans are insular groups that keep to themselves, so which of Harper's 'Big Four' motives will it turn out to be? Love, lust, loathing, or loot? She's determined to find out-but in order to do so she'll have to deal with an unexpected curveball Krieg has pitched her way, a distraction her homesick heart has trouble ignoring...
